70th Annual Rotary Crab Feast 
From the Bay to the Earth
Today, Friday, Aug. 7
 
We are working with the Annapolis Rotary to make the iconic 70th Annual Crab Feast a "Bay Responsible," Zero-Waste event through our Responsible Events & Festivals Program (The Green REF... Make the Right Call).

Last year we composted over 20,000 pounds of food waste from the Crab Feast and it will be even more this year because we connected Rotary with Baltimore company Leonard Paper to obtain compostables.

That means that this year EVERYTHING except recyclable beverage cups and bottles will be composted. Compostables include knives, forks, spoons, trays, plates, and paper goods. Congratulations to Rotary for its commitment to the environment!

 

We will be there making sure that recyclables go into our blue Keep America Beautiful bins and that compostables go into Veteran Compost's totes. This year ALL waste/trash will fit into one of these categories so NOTHING will go to the landfill!


 

Close to 2500 feasters are expected to enjoy the bounty of the summer at the Navy Marine Corps Memorial Stadium this evening from 5 to 8 p.m. You can buy tickets online or at the gate.

Become a Watershed Steward  
 
The Watershed Stewards Academy is currently accepting applications for the 2015-2016 Class of Master Watershed Stewards that will begin on October 24.

The WSA certification course trains and supports citizens to become Master Watershed Stewards. Master Watershed Stewards take action with their neighbors to address the problem of stormwater pollution and restore local waterways in Anne Arundel County.
